3,536 Steps to Miles, By Height
The 2,000-steps-per-mile figure above is a flat average. Stride length actually scales with height, so the same 3,536 steps covers a different distance depending on how tall the walker is.
| Height | Distance |
|---|---|
| Short (~5'2") | 1.43 mi |
| Average (~5'7") | 1.55 mi |
| Tall (~6'2") | 1.71 mi |

Where 3,536 Steps Ranks
Activity levels are commonly grouped by daily step count. Here's where 3,536 steps falls.
| Activity Level | Daily Steps |
|---|---|
| Sedentary | Under 5,000 |
| Low Active | 5,000–7,499 |
| Somewhat Active | 7,500–9,999 |
| Active | 10,000–12,499 |
| Highly Active | 12,500+ |
Did You Know?
Olympic race walkers can cover a mile in under 6 minutes, but they have to keep at least one foot on the ground at all times or risk disqualification, a rule that's surprisingly hard for judges to call correctly at that speed.
Walking upright costs humans roughly a quarter of the energy that walking on all fours would, according to a study comparing human and chimpanzee locomotion. That efficiency is a big part of why our ancestors could travel further between food sources as forests thinned into open grassland.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is 3,536 steps a lot?
It's less than the average U.S. adult walks in a day. 3,536 steps is about 40% of the NHANES-measured daily average of 8,818 steps.
How long does it take to walk 3,536 steps?
At an average walking pace of about 3 mph, 3,536 steps takes roughly 35 min. Walking slower or faster will shift that time up or down.
